Laura Christina Guenther, 89, of West Point, died January 7, 2006 at St. Joseph’s Retirement Community in West Point. Mass of Christian Burial will be 10:30 am. Tuesday at St. Mary’s Catholic Church with Reverend Frank Lordemann as celebrant. Guild and Christian Mother’s Rosary will be 1:30 pm. Monday with Public Wake Services 7:00 pm. Monday both at Stokely Funeral Home. Burial will be at St. Michael’s Cemetery. Memorials may be made to the Church or Guardian Angels Endowment. Visitation will be 9:00 am. until 8:00 pm. Monday at the Funeral Home. Those wishing to leave on line condolences may do so at www.stokelyfuneralhome.com.Laura was born May 15, 1916 on the family farm north of Dodge to Anton and Mary Rolf Stieren. She attended District #41 Country School and received her religious education at St. Joseph’s Catholic Church in Dodge. A young Laura worked as a hired girl for families with new babies. On February 14, 1944 at St. Mary’s Catholic Church in West Point she married John Guenther, Jr. The couple farmed 4 miles west of West Point where Laura tended a large garden and raised chickens. During the 1970’s, Laura worked in the laundry department at the West Point Living Center. They retired to West Point in the early 1990’s and Laura moved to St. Joseph’s in October of 2002. Laura was a member of St. Mary’s Catholic Church, Guild and Christian Mothers. She enjoyed crocheting and quilting. Laura was a quiet, humble person that took pride in her family and religion. Survivors include her daughters Mary Ann Guenther and Doris Raasch both of Grand Island, Jeanette (Jack) Kindschuh of West Point, sons Gerald of Scribner and Ron (Teresa) of Lincoln, sisters Eleanor Spenner and Beatrice (Mac) Seaman both of Beemer, grandchildren Kari Nosal, Dan Kindschuh, Jon Raasch, David, Tim and Mary Guenther, great grandchildren Brooklyn Kindschuh and Emma Nosal. She is preceded in death by her husband John, Jr., in May of 1994, sister Minnie Kuehler, brothers Edward, Hilbert and Gerhart Stieren.
